Brutus Buckeye is driving north on OH-315 at 29.0 m/s when he sees Hugh Jackman, The Wolverine, driving south on OH-315 at 30.5 m/s and waves at him. Hugh blasts his 500 Hz horns as they pass. Assume all travel in this problem happens in a straight line. a. As they travel towards each other, what wavelength of sound does Brutus hear.
b. After they pass each other (maintaining their original speeds), what wavelength of sound does Brutus hear?
c. All this honking causes a traffic jam and both cars come to a complete stop 200 m apart. What wavelength of sound does Brutus hear now?
